If this is something that you are interested in, one of the primary things to keep in mind is whether you wish to work with a local government or the state government. So, what is the difference between the two? Essentially, local governments are accountable for a range of important services for people and businesses in specified areas of the country, while the state government is the primary governing body of the whole nation. Despite the fact that local government are practically the lowest tiers of governance, they still do extremely essential work and can result in several gratifying jobs. Additionally, a few of the best local government jobs examples in councils consists of being a social worker, a planning official or a health and safety manager etc. The most effective feature of working for your local government is that you can give back to your community and touch the lives of people who live around you.

Because the list of careers in government is so long and diverse, among the very best ideas is to try to narrow down your career search to ensure that you are looking within only one of the government branches. Whilst is differs from country to nation, the majority of governments all over the world are separated into multiple branches and departments, which is why it is a great recommendation to narrow down your search to one major area. As an example, you may decide that the government branch you are most interested in is the judicial branch of federal government, which is the system of courts that interprets, defends, and applies the law in specific lawful cases. If this is an industry that you have an interest in, having a law certification and some work experience at a legal practice is likely to be necessary.
